IBM InfoSphere Optim is ranked 17th in Database Development and Management with 3 reviews while Oracle GoldenGate is ranked 6th in Data Integration with 47 reviews. IBM InfoSphere Optim is rated 6.6, while Oracle GoldenGate is rated 8.2. The top reviewer of IBM InfoSphere Optim writes "Can easily restore the database, but the cost needs to be reduced". On the other hand, the top reviewer of Oracle GoldenGate writes "Performs real-time replication without data loss, but we cannot do much automation". IBM InfoSphere Optim is most compared with Solix Enterprise Data Management, Informatica Data Archive, Informatica Persistent Data Masking and Oracle Enterprise Manager, whereas Oracle GoldenGate is most compared with AWS Database Migration Service, Qlik Replicate, Quest SharePlex, Azure Data Factory and Oracle Data Integrator (ODI).
